A silver lining of being a highly sensitive kid is heightened social and emotional intelligence. New study of elementary schoolers: The more they feel things deeply, the better they are at recognizing emotions and handling conflicts. Sensitivity is not a flaw—it's a feature.

My mom, a retired principal/district leader through the NCLB era, talked about the common practice of putting the strongest teachers in grades 3 and up, when students take state assessments She always tried to put her best teachers in 1st grade. More of this, please.
